Plant Part Low PPM High PPM StdDev *Reference
Abrus precatorius Seed -- -- -- Wealth of India.
Aquilegia vulgaris Plant -- -- -- *
Pisum sativum Flower -- -- -- *
Punica granatum Pericarp -- -- -- Rizk, A.F.M. and Al-Nowaihi, A.S., The Phytochemistry of the Horticultural Plants of Qatar, Scientific and Applied Research Centre, University of Qatar.
Vigna radiata Seed -- -- -- *
Vitis vinifera Fruit -- -- -- List, P.H. and Horhammer, L., Hager's Handbuch der Pharmazeutischen Praxis, Vols. 2-6, Springer-Verlag, Berlin, 1969-1979.
*Unless otherwise noted all references are to Duke, James A. 1992. Handbook of phytochemical constituents of GRAS herbs and other economic plants. Boca Raton, FL. CRC Press.
